MAYOR'S YOUTH ADVISORY COUNCIL Tuesday, November 11, 2025 at 5:00 PM 213 North Race Street Everman, TX 76140 MINUTES 1. MEETING CALLED TO ORDER Craig called meeting to order at 5:01pm. Present: Leah Martinez Audrianna Mangram Phoebe Dudley Citlali Martinez Jesus Davila Furaha Mwangi Miriam Davila Absent: Karen Velasco 2. INVOCATION 3. PLEDGE OF ALLEGIANCE 4. CONSENT AGENDA 5. PRESENTATIONS 6. CITIZEN’S COMMENTS 7. DISCUSSION ITEMS A. Introductions of Staff and Members of the MYAC Craig Spencer introduced himself and explained his job to the Youth Council. We also went around the table and everyone introduced themselves to the council and staff and said a little bit about themselves or what we do as city staff. B. Review & Discussion Related to the Purpose of the Mayor's Youth Advisory Council This Mayor's Youth Advisory Council will give the Everman City Council their input and learn how the city runs. Craig explained to the MYAC what their duties of this council are and explained how they will present their recommendation of the MYAC Project for the FY 2026 as well once they deliberate on that to the Everman City Council. 8. CONSIDERATION AND POSSIBLE ACTION A. Election of Officers for MYAC Motion was made by Davila and seconded by Leah Martinez to appoint Furaha Mwangi President of the Mayor's Youth Advisory Council. All voted Aye Motion was made by Leah Martinez and seconded by Citlali Martinez to appoint Jesus Davila Vice President of the Mayor's Youth Advisory Council. All Voted Aye Motion was made by Mwangi and seconded by Dudley to appoint Leah Martinez Secretary to the Mayor's Youth Advisory Council All Voted Aye Motion was made by Mwangi and seconded by Leah Martinez to appoint Citlali Martinez Treasure of the Mayor's Youth Advisory Council All Voted Aye B. Discussion and Consideration of Establishing a MYAC Project for the FY 2026 Secretary Leah addressed the council to inform them the project they they had last year for them to take before the council for approval. They put this whole project together and had a layout and drawings of a new Recreation Center. Park improvements for Johnson and Pittman Park as well is a project that they Mayor has recommended for them to do this year for the project that they want to take before the council. This is something the city is already looking into as well. The lighting, walking trails, and many more things to get our parks better and better accessible for the citizens and kids. This project would be creating a master plan for all the Parks. The council can do anything they would like and do not have to make that decision today. C. Discussion and Consideration of Establishing Regular Meeting Dates, Times, & Location The Council has decided to have their meetings on the same day as the Everman council on the second Tuesday of the month at 5pm. In January they will start having the second meeting of the month on the fourth Tuesday of the month at the High School. 9. EXECUTIVE SESSION 10. ADJOURN President Mwangi adjourned the meeting at 5:50pm.
